Annual General Meeting of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G for Fiscal Year 2003/2004 |
 |
| 07/21/2004 |
 |
- Sales excluding Web Systems and Digital in first quarter of fiscal year 2004/2005 slightly up on previous year
- High level of incoming orders thanks to drupa successes
At the Annual General Meeting of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G (Heidelberg), which will commence today at 10 a.m. at the Stadthalle Heidelberg, Bernhard Schreier, the Company's Chief Executive Officer, will provide preliminary information on incoming orders and sales for Heidelberg's first quarter (April 1 - June 30, 2004). The group's preliminary figures for incoming orders in the first three months of fiscal year 2004/2005 are just under 1.3 billion Euro (previous year: 783 million Euro), thanks to the numerous contracts concluded at the drupa trade show. This provides an excellent platform for sales in the coming quarters. Preliminary sales in the first three months of fiscal year 2004/2005 are 710 million Euro (previous year: 741 million Euro). Excluding sales from the Web Systems and Digital divisions, which were divested during the current fiscal year, preliminary sales are 602 million Euro, slightly above the comparable figure for the previous year (595 million Euro). The full financial statements for the first quarter will be published on August 9.
Today, the company's shareholders will vote on seven items of the agenda. These will cover the following issues:
- Because of the negative result, the Management Board and the Supervisory Board propose at today's Annual General Meeting that no dividend be paid for the year under review.
- Jan Zilius, Member of the Executive Board of RWE AG, will resign from the Supervisory Board of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G with effect from the end of the Annual General Meeting.
- The current Chairman of the Supervisory Board, Dr. Klaus Sturany, will resign his post as Chairman once all the seats on the Supervisory Board are occupied again. Sturany, CFO at RWE AG, will remain a member of the Heidelberg Supervisory Board.
- Following his forthcoming appointment by the courts to the Supervisory Board of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G, Dr. Mark Wössner is to replace Klaus Sturany as Chairman of the Supervisory Board.

Company Profile
Over the course of its more than 150-year history, Heidelberg has grown from a traditional printing press manufacturer to become the world's largest solutions provider for the print media industry. With its seamlessly integrated hardware and software solutions, it has established a commanding lead over other market players. Heidelberg is a one-stop supplier of everything from prepress solutions to a wide range of products for printing and finishing processes, relevant training and accompanying services.
